Fushigi, often referred to as "fushigi ball" or "fushigi magic gravity ball," can be fun for those who enjoy tricks and illusions. It involves manipulating a reflective ball to create the appearance of it floating or moving effortlessly in the hands. Many find it a relaxing and engaging hobby, while others may not find it as captivating. Overall, its enjoyment largely depends on personal interest in juggling and visual performance.

Magic relight birthday candles work by having a small amount of magnesium in the wick that reignites the candle after it is blown out. You can find them at party supply stores, online retailers, and some grocery stores in the birthday section.

There are two kinds of Magic stores. One kind of magic is the "street" or "performance" magic. This is what an illusionist does and there are great shops around the world dedicated to just that. There is also Ritual Magic practiced by Pagans of dozens of paths. You will find Pagan, New Age, Wiccan shops and books stores throughout the world as well. The two are not the same so going into one type of store looking for the other kind of magic will be very frustrating for all concerned.
